Financial Stewardship

Each year, we publish simple, clear reports showing how funds are spent. Most donations support on-the-ground programs in Nigeria; a smaller portion covers essential administration and fundraising—ensuring long-term impact and sustainability.

Typical Allocation:
▪ 80% Programs and Services
▪ 15% Administration
▪ 5% Fundraising

Governance & Compliance

Oma HelpingHands Foundation is registered in Texas, USA, as a nonprofit organization and operates in full compliance with state regulations. Our U.S. board provides oversight to ensure integrity in all financial and operational activities.

In Nigeria, our field team implements programs directly and reports outcomes for full accountability. Donations are securely processed through trusted platforms such as Paystack, PayPal, and Stripe.
